aCC是HP公司的商业C++编译器,以下是一些编译选项的用法。
1) -AA 全面支持C++(HPUX PA上编译C++时的必须选项)
2) -V 查看版本
3) +DD64 编译64位程序 +DD32编译32位程序,在64位系统上默认编译的是32位程序。
4) +DAportable 跨版本编译
5) -lpthread 支持POSIX线程
6) -lrt 支持POSIX消息队列
7) -D_REENTRANT 支持localtime_r,time_r,asctime_r
8) -D_INCLUDE__STDC_A1_SOURCE 支持Unicode(wprintf)
9) -D_INCLUDE_LONGLONG 支持long long类型
10) acc使用+Markered开关编译出cpp文件所需的头文件,并以xxx.d文件形式存放
11)多线程程序需要加-mt
12) 编译静态库用ar
13)编译动态库用-b开关